Westward View is in Newton Abbot and in Teignbridge district. TQ12 4DT is located in the Buckland & Milber elect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Newton Abbot.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Westward View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Westward View was 21.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 75.7% lower than the Buckland & Milber average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Westward View has the 10th lowest crime rate of 58 local areas in Buckland & Milber and the 108th lowest crime rate of 430 local areas in Teignbridge .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 18.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-30.3%.

Employment

TQ12 4DT area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in TQ12 4DT area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 45%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
